Chickadees All Around

Chestnut-backed Chickadee Chestnut-backed Chickadee

We saw a lot of Chestnut-backed Chickadees during the hike, and they seemed to be everywhere we looked. Their constant activity and cheerful calls made them one of the stars of the day.

A Special Family Moment

Chestnut-backed Chickadees Chestnut-backed Chickadees

One of our favorite sightings came when we watched a fledgling Chestnut-backed Chickadee being fed by one of its parents. It was a wonderful glimpse into the busy nesting season and one of those moments that makes birdwatching so rewarding.

Wrens and Thrushes

Pacific Wren Pacific Wren

Many Pacific Wrens filled the forest with their energetic songs, while a couple of Swainson's Thrushes quietly moved through the understory.
